Safety EStop Changes

added SCS EStop to FSOE connection to main safety and it's evaluation
This commit is contained in:
Markus Neukirch
2025-08-05 17:16:25 +02:00
parent 6f357a3913
commit 6f97c1aa6b
5 changed files with 168 additions and 32 deletions

View File

@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="utf-8"?>
<safetyApplication Crc="207658283" xmlns:dm0="http://schemas.microsoft.com/VisualStudio/2008/DslTools/Core" dslVersion="1.5.0.0" Id="9612a4fe-bcc7-44ac-98eb-591c855d3593" name="" mapState="false" mapDiag="false" groupOrderId="0" passificationAllowed="false" temporaryDeactivationAllowed="false" permamentDeactivationAllowed="false" xmlid="0" analogFBOutputReplacementValues="Zero" verifyAnalogFBInputsIfStart="false" userFbId="00000000-0000-0000-0000-000000000000" xmlns="http://schemas.microsoft.com/dsltools/SafetyApplicationLanguage">
<safetyApplication Crc="2147460385" xmlns:dm0="http://schemas.microsoft.com/VisualStudio/2008/DslTools/Core" dslVersion="1.5.0.0" Id="9612a4fe-bcc7-44ac-98eb-591c855d3593" name="" mapState="false" mapDiag="false" groupOrderId="0" passificationAllowed="false" temporaryDeactivationAllowed="false" permamentDeactivationAllowed="false" xmlid="0" analogFBOutputReplacementValues="Zero" verifyAnalogFBInputsIfStart="false" userFbId="00000000-0000-0000-0000-000000000000" xmlns="http://schemas.microsoft.com/dsltools/SafetyApplicationLanguage">
<networks>
<safetyApplicationHasNetworks Id="380f5fd8-ba2a-45bb-a78e-f84c8d89382d">
<Network Id="11bb88f4-a35c-49d9-88d3-88e91ad6a621" name="Network1" networkName="Network1" intId="1" networkOrderId="0">
@@ -53,16 +53,40 @@
</inPort>
</functioBlockHasInPorts>
<functioBlockHasInPorts Id="e18f10ac-1636-4ff2-a9e7-22b67c0c05f5">
<inPort Id="64515727-5f9a-4ef4-974a-7ade4f8c0d7e" name="EStopIn5" portName="EStopIn5" portNum="8" objectIndex="12" varId="7" filter="2" portDataType="1" channelInterface="Both Deactivated" maxDeviation="0" resetTime="0" />
<inPort Id="64515727-5f9a-4ef4-974a-7ade4f8c0d7e" name="EStopIn5" portName="EStopIn5" portNum="8" objectIndex="12" varId="7" filter="2" portDataType="1" channelInterface="Two-Channel" discrepancyTime="200" deactivate1="Break Contact (NC)" deactivate2="Break Contact (NC)" maxDeviation="0" resetTime="0">
<fbPortGlobalVariableReferences>
<functionBlockPortHasFbPortGlobalVariableReferences Id="d0e4bccd-c04a-4fc7-a8aa-4009ba8f9ea9">
<fbPortGlobalVariableReference Id="9be8c636-83d0-4402-aef2-36af381eea9b" variableId="3666207e-b87b-470a-a00e-dc8cf9a39624" lastKnownPath="GVL1.xNotHaltRegalString1Ch1" />
</functionBlockPortHasFbPortGlobalVariableReferences>
</fbPortGlobalVariableReferences>
</inPort>
</functioBlockHasInPorts>
<functioBlockHasInPorts Id="219431b7-61de-40c2-ba06-14dc1af4dbcc">
<inPort Id="5203a339-fdf3-49a3-949c-21580a00e54e" name="EStopIn6" portName="EStopIn6" portNum="9" objectIndex="13" varId="8" filter="2" portDataType="1" channelInterface="Both Deactivated" maxDeviation="0" resetTime="0" />
<inPort Id="5203a339-fdf3-49a3-949c-21580a00e54e" name="EStopIn6" portName="EStopIn6" portNum="9" objectIndex="13" varId="8" filter="2" portDataType="1" channelInterface="Both Deactivated" maxDeviation="0" resetTime="0">
<fbPortGlobalVariableReferences>
<functionBlockPortHasFbPortGlobalVariableReferences Id="bdeeda55-5483-4eed-85bf-102f2195f45b">
<fbPortGlobalVariableReference Id="9eafdf62-e19c-4470-a7f0-03ebe2f72179" variableId="b89e5a29-9951-4f77-87d6-c370b60789c8" lastKnownPath="GVL1.xNotHaltRegalString1Ch2" />
</functionBlockPortHasFbPortGlobalVariableReferences>
</fbPortGlobalVariableReferences>
</inPort>
</functioBlockHasInPorts>
<functioBlockHasInPorts Id="617abe78-c228-41b1-b47b-083e76a2bd1b">
<inPort Id="b0e41880-05c6-4369-96c8-e159ad9f71b9" name="EStopIn7" portName="EStopIn7" portNum="10" objectIndex="14" varId="9" filter="2" portDataType="1" channelInterface="Both Deactivated" maxDeviation="0" resetTime="0" />
<inPort Id="b0e41880-05c6-4369-96c8-e159ad9f71b9" name="EStopIn7" portName="EStopIn7" portNum="10" objectIndex="14" varId="9" filter="2" portDataType="1" channelInterface="Two-Channel" discrepancyTime="200" deactivate1="Break Contact (NC)" deactivate2="Break Contact (NC)" maxDeviation="0" resetTime="0">
<fbPortGlobalVariableReferences>
<functionBlockPortHasFbPortGlobalVariableReferences Id="9f9bbd59-324d-4938-8fb9-bb230c03614e">
<fbPortGlobalVariableReference Id="bd61aa44-d242-4c81-a398-1711550bd970" variableId="73fa5b99-a58a-4c74-817d-5d26701aa3d8" lastKnownPath="GVL1.xNotHaltRegalString2Ch1" />
</functionBlockPortHasFbPortGlobalVariableReferences>
</fbPortGlobalVariableReferences>
</inPort>
</functioBlockHasInPorts>
<functioBlockHasInPorts Id="ea4c058c-52c8-4e24-b966-dbbb294f9ed0">
<inPort Id="a84723e7-49ae-438e-a184-3cd0a05ad119" name="EStopIn8" portName="EStopIn8" portNum="11" objectIndex="15" varId="10" filter="2" portDataType="1" channelInterface="Both Deactivated" maxDeviation="0" resetTime="0" />
<inPort Id="a84723e7-49ae-438e-a184-3cd0a05ad119" name="EStopIn8" portName="EStopIn8" portNum="11" objectIndex="15" varId="10" filter="2" portDataType="1" channelInterface="Both Deactivated" maxDeviation="0" resetTime="0">
<fbPortGlobalVariableReferences>
<functionBlockPortHasFbPortGlobalVariableReferences Id="0e33f61a-4cfb-4526-ab31-fde1a3b63c8f">
<fbPortGlobalVariableReference Id="1748d0a0-03c9-4bf3-bfe3-f566b987902e" variableId="eb89a43f-f715-4c55-9198-694215469e51" lastKnownPath="GVL1.xNotHaltRegalString2Ch2" />
</functionBlockPortHasFbPortGlobalVariableReferences>
</fbPortGlobalVariableReferences>
</inPort>
</functioBlockHasInPorts>
<functioBlockHasInPorts Id="cfd6247a-0399-4723-b17d-4949669641bf">
<inPort Id="b1159fe1-4d2e-4ab2-8e1c-67881350d8a5" name="EDM1" portName="EDM1" portNum="13" objectIndex="1" varId="12" filter="3" portDataType="1" maxDeviation="0" resetTime="0" />